The movie follows the story of Phil Wenneck (played by Bradley Cooper), a teacher; Stuart Price (played by Ed Helms), a dentist; and Alan Garner (played by Zach Galifianakis), a behavioral therapist, who travel to Las Vegas for a bachelor party to celebrate their friend Doug's (played by Justin Bartha) upcoming wedding.
